New-look NT revamps its online offering

By Press Gazette

Nursing Times has relaunched its website and redesigned its print version.

From Tuesday registered users will be able to access an enhanced breakingnews service, additional information on the magazine’s news stories under the banner of “News Plus”, background articles on major issues in nursing and a section scrutinising the media’s health stories called “Behind the Headlines”.

Registered users of nursingtimes.net will also receive additional online-only information on nursing practice. The 4,000 peer-reviewed articles in NT’s archive will also be easier to access with an improved search function.

Nursing Times’ Careers section has moved online and includes a new careers advice service.

The magazine will provide more comment, analysis and nurses’ views and opinions.
